当前位置: 首页 > news >正文

5138: 数字游戏

描述

爸爸、妈妈还有YuYu一起玩一个数字游戏,玩家从某个数开始挨个轮流报数,当数字里含有4或7时,不能报出该数字,只能拍一下手。

报数的顺序总是从YuYu开始,然后妈妈、爸爸,最后回到YuYu,以此类推,当数字超过1000时,游戏结束。

现在的问题是,YuYu哪几个数需要拍手。

输入

输入包含1个正整数(小于1000),表示YuYu一开始报出的数(不含4或7)。

输出

输出YuYu需要拍手的数字,每行一个。

YuYu没有拍过手,则在最后一行输出“Smile”,不含双引号。

样例输入

991

样例输出

994

997

#include <stdio.h>

#include <string.h>

#include <math.h>

int main()

{

int flag,x,i,n,m,sign;

scanf("%d",&x);

sign=0;

for(i=x;i<=1000;i=i+3){

n=i;

flag=0;

while(n){

m=n%10;;

n=n/10;

if(m==4||m==7){

flag=1; sign=1; break;

}

}

if(flag==1)

printf("%d\n",i);

}

if(sign==0)printf("Smile\n");

return 0;

}

http://www.lryc.cn/news/20554.html

相关文章:

  • 阅读笔记9——DenseNet
  • PowerAutomation获取邮件附件并删除这个邮件方法
  • websocket报错集锦-不断更新中
  • Spring Cloud Nacos源码讲解(七)- Nacos客户端服务订阅机制的核心流程
  • 【华为OD机试模拟题】用 C++ 实现 - 对称美学(2023.Q1)
  • Go语言内存管理详解-学习笔记
  • Geospatial Data Science (4): Spatial weights
  • JUC-Synchronized相关内容
  • 【c++】文件操作(文本文件、二进制文件)
  • 带你了解IP报警柱的特点
  • 一步步教你电脑变成服务器,tomcat的花生壳设置(原创)
  • Python 卷积神经网络 ResNet的基本编写方法
  • 【索引】什么是索引
  • 【算法刷题】动态规划算法题型及方法归纳
  • PolarDB数据库的CSN机制
  • 使用kubeadm 部署kubernetes 1.26.1集群 Calico ToR配置
  • Servlet笔记(11):Servletcontext对象
  • EM算法是什么
  • C++---线性dp---方格取数(每日一道算法2023.2.25)
  • 《第一行代码》 第八章:应用手机多媒体
  • C++设计模式(20)——迭代器模式
  • 戴尔Latitude 3410电脑 Hackintosh 黑苹果efi引导文件
  • 一起Talk Android吧(第五百零四回:如何调整组件在约束布局中的位置)
  • ssh连不上实验室的物理机了
  • selinux讲解
  • 【计算机网络】TCP底层设计交互原理
  • Kotlin1.8新特性
  • 【Java8】
  • 阿里 Java 程序员面试经验分享,附带个人学习笔记、路线大纲
  • 十大算法基础——上(共有20道例题,大多数为简单题)